Java又出包了 - MAC
By Caroline
at 2013-02-03T11:55
at 2013-02-03T11:55
Table of Contents
最新的消息
從Thu, 31 Jan 2013 04:41:14 GMT開始
Apple (所有瀏覽器)也開始擋Java 1.7.0_11 和 Java 1.6.0_37 以下的版本了
http://goo.gl/oMgHh (2013/01/31)
Oracle隨後也釋出Java 1.7.0_13 和 Java 1.6.0_39 來因應
http://goo.gl/07PW6 (2013/02/01)
Java 7的使用者很簡單 直接抓Oracle的新版就好
但重點是 Apple的Java 1.6.0_39 (Java for Mac OS X v10.6 Update 12)
只能給Snow Leopard使用者更新
OS X 10.7以上的使用者就強迫你升到最新的Java 7 除非... (底下有解法)
如果只是 "想在10.8.x上用Chrome來登入網路郵局" 的慣用者應該對這點很困擾
因為Java 7不支援如Chrome的32-bit瀏覽器
以前還可以用 http://support.apple.com/kb/HT5559 來還原成Java 1.6.0_37
但現在這個版本被擋了
Apple又不給10.7以上的使用者升Java 6
只能靠底下這招:
====================== 2013/02/21 update ====================
Apple現在出了for 10.7以上的Java for OS X 2013-001
和Java for Mac OS X 10.6 Update 13
一舉更新到1.6.0_41 所以現在沒有這個的困擾囉
10.7以上載點:http://support.apple.com/kb/DL1572
10.6載點:http://support.apple.com/kb/DL1573 (也可以從內建的軟體更新)
================ 以下方法不需要了,僅供備份 =================
https://discussions.apple.com/message/21097499#21097499 (alucasTHX)
[以下將使系統暴露在舊版Java的安全風險 請考慮過且看懂步驟再執行 搞砸不負責]
打開應用程式/工具程式/終端機,以管理員權限編輯這個plist檔:
sudo vim /System/Library/CoreServices/CoreTypes.bundle/Contents/
/Resources/XProtect.meta.plist
(以上指令請合成一行 系統會要求輸入密碼)
按 i 進入編輯模式 (畫面下方是-- INSERT --)
把<key>JavaWebComponentVersionMinimum</key>
<string>1.6.0_37-b06-435</string>
改成<key>JavaWebComponentVersionMinimum</key>
<string>1.6.0_37-b06-434</string>
按下ESC -> 輸入:wq存檔離開
這樣所有瀏覽器就能跳過Apple的Java版本檢查了
不過長遠一點還是希望Apple也能讓10.7以上的系統能跑"最新版本的Java 6"
或是Chrome on Mac早日升級成64-bit啊!
--
It's nice to be important, but it's more important to be nice.
--
從Thu, 31 Jan 2013 04:41:14 GMT開始
Apple (所有瀏覽器)也開始擋Java 1.7.0_11 和 Java 1.6.0_37 以下的版本了
http://goo.gl/oMgHh (2013/01/31)
Oracle隨後也釋出Java 1.7.0_13 和 Java 1.6.0_39 來因應
http://goo.gl/07PW6 (2013/02/01)
Java 7的使用者很簡單 直接抓Oracle的新版就好
但重點是 Apple的Java 1.6.0_39 (Java for Mac OS X v10.6 Update 12)
只能給Snow Leopard使用者更新
OS X 10.7以上的使用者就強迫你升到最新的Java 7 除非... (底下有解法)
如果只是 "想在10.8.x上用Chrome來登入網路郵局" 的慣用者應該對這點很困擾
因為Java 7不支援如Chrome的32-bit瀏覽器
以前還可以用 http://support.apple.com/kb/HT5559 來還原成Java 1.6.0_37
但現在這個版本被擋了
Apple又不給10.7以上的使用者升Java 6
只能靠底下這招:
====================== 2013/02/21 update ====================
Apple現在出了for 10.7以上的Java for OS X 2013-001
和Java for Mac OS X 10.6 Update 13
一舉更新到1.6.0_41 所以現在沒有這個的困擾囉
10.7以上載點:http://support.apple.com/kb/DL1572
10.6載點:http://support.apple.com/kb/DL1573 (也可以從內建的軟體更新)
================ 以下方法不需要了,僅供備份 =================
https://discussions.apple.com/message/21097499#21097499 (alucasTHX)
[以下將使系統暴露在舊版Java的安全風險 請考慮過且看懂步驟再執行 搞砸不負責]
打開應用程式/工具程式/終端機,以管理員權限編輯這個plist檔:
sudo vim /System/Library/CoreServices/CoreTypes.bundle/Contents/
/Resources/XProtect.meta.plist
(以上指令請合成一行 系統會要求輸入密碼)
按 i 進入編輯模式 (畫面下方是-- INSERT --)
把<key>JavaWebComponentVersionMinimum</key>
<string>1.6.0_37-b06-435</string>
改成<key>JavaWebComponentVersionMinimum</key>
<string>1.6.0_37-b06-434</string>
按下ESC -> 輸入:wq存檔離開
這樣所有瀏覽器就能跳過Apple的Java版本檢查了
不過長遠一點還是希望Apple也能讓10.7以上的系統能跑"最新版本的Java 6"
或是Chrome on Mac早日升級成64-bit啊!
--
It's nice to be important, but it's more important to be nice.
--
Tags:
MAC
All Comments
By Edwina
at 2013-02-06T07:41
at 2013-02-06T07:41
By Edith
at 2013-02-07T09:00
at 2013-02-07T09:00
By Michael
at 2013-02-07T18:53
at 2013-02-07T18:53
By Kyle
at 2013-02-12T00:36
at 2013-02-12T00:36
By Hedda
at 2013-02-14T14:06
at 2013-02-14T14:06
By Joseph
at 2013-02-19T12:34
at 2013-02-19T12:34
By David
at 2013-02-22T03:04
at 2013-02-22T03:04
By Vanessa
at 2013-02-22T23:18
at 2013-02-22T23:18
Related Posts
airport extreme連接硬碟
By Jacky
at 2013-02-03T08:29
at 2013-02-03T08:29
Airport Extreme 外接硬碟格式
By Tom
at 2013-02-03T01:23
at 2013-02-03T01:23
iphoto 資料庫過大
By William
at 2013-02-02T23:16
at 2013-02-02T23:16
better touch tool 最新版本常失效!?
By Barb Cronin
at 2013-02-02T21:35
at 2013-02-02T21:35
apple tv airplay 聲音問題
By Hedy
at 2013-02-02T18:21
at 2013-02-02T18:21